NEW YORK - A fire has erupted at a New York City church.



Firefighters say the blaze was reported Wednesday night at a church in Brooklyn. They say the fire didn't spread beyond the Baptist Temple Church and was deemed under control by early Thursday morning.

Four firefighters have suffered minor injuries.

The cause of the fire hasn't been determined.
